Warm & Cozy Sweaters
As soon as you think of workwear, a cozy, warm sweater is something that will cross your mind as a winter staple. Additionally, it serves to be a great investment for both in & outside the work environment.
Effective materials like wool serve to be natural insulators. Therefore, these outfits help prevent you from losing the precious body heat to the chilly winds outside. You can go ahead with layering a cozy wool coat on top of the sweater to offer an additional layer of warmth and comfort. For your perfect office look, consider pairing your beautiful sweater with a maxi skirt or a pleated midi skirt to bring about the perfect casual winter work outfit.

What are the Don’ts in Dressing Professionally?
- Do Not Overcompensate or Over-Accessorize: Avoid falling into the trap of overcompensating by over-accessorizing yourself. Try keeping your layering to a minimum of around three items, including a jumper or cardigan, an oversized coat, or a puffer jacket to finish the look.
- Do Not Stick to Black: While black might appear as the quintessential shade for your winter workwear, try experimenting with other colors as well. Do include interesting winter hues to your wardrobe as well, including blue, charcoal gray, or burgundy.
- Do Not Wear White Socks or Suede Footwear: The overall sludge and mud during the winter season can be a major problem for white socks or suede footwear pieces.

How can one effectively layer clothing for the office without looking overly bulky?
You can go ahead with wearing a thin yet warm winter base to hug the skin. Then, you can start layering wisely without adding the bulk. Choose lightweight, warm winter outfits rather than bulky outfits to complete your look.
